20 May : Dr Yaduguri Sandinti Rajasekhara Reddy has been sworn-in as Andhra Pradesh Chief Minister for the second consecutive term Hyderabad on Wednesday evening. Yeduguri Sandinti Rajasekhara Reddy (58) has been sworn-in the 22nd Chief Minister of Andhra Pradesh at the Lal Bahadur Shastri stadium in Hyderabad today.Governor Narayan Dutt Tiwari administered the oath of office and secrecy to Reddy amidst a huge gathering of over 20,000 people, including MPs, MLAs, bureaucrats and other dignitaries.
Reddy took the oath in the name of God in Telugu.After administering the oath, Tiwari blessed the Chief Minister. He also blessed the Reddy’s wife Vijayalaxmi and grandson.Chief Minister’s son and MP-elect Y S Jaganmohan Reddy, his wife and other family members watched the proceedings from among the audience.
Reddy took the oath alone today. He is expected to constitute his Council of Ministers on 22nd May.
